A leading nursery care provider in Preston is seeking a Room Leader to join their team. In this role, you will manage a room, ensuring high-quality care and education in line with the EYFS. This position offers competitive benefits and a supportive work culture.

Responsibilities

  • Manage a room and ensure high-quality care and education in line with the EYFS.
  • Support a collaborative team environment.
  • Foster strong relationships with families.

Qualifications

  • Level 3 qualification in early years.
  • Strong knowledge of safeguarding and EYFS standards.

How to prepare for a job interview at Job Search Place Limited

Know Your EYFS Inside Out

Make sure you brush up on your knowledge of the Early Years Foundation Stage (EYFS) standards. Be prepared to discuss how you would implement these in your room and provide examples from your past experience.

Showcase Your Leadership Skills

As a Room Leader, you'll need to demonstrate your ability to manage a team effectively. Think of specific instances where you've led a team or resolved conflicts, and be ready to share those stories during the interview.

Build Rapport with Families

Since fostering strong relationships with families is key, come prepared with ideas on how you would engage parents and caregivers. Share any successful strategies you've used in the past to build trust and communication.

Prepare Questions for Them

Interviews are a two-way street! Prepare thoughtful questions about their nursery's culture, team dynamics, and how they support professional development. This shows you're genuinely interested and helps you assess if it's the right fit for you.
